Myth 2: Only the aged and immunosuppressed individuals are in danger for COVID-19
Another fable is that now solely the aged or immunocompromised can develop extreme types of Covid-19. Each organism is exclusive, and it’s not attainable to foretell how people will react to this illness. Furthermore, for younger individuals, “even gentle infections can result in long-term circumstances of Covid”, they warn. In the UK, the situation impacts one in 5 adults aged 18-64.
Myth 3: Children aren’t affected by Covid-19
Children are nonetheless very weak to covid-19, long-term covid and different issues, equivalent to loss of life. On the opposite hand, worldwide, vaccination charges for this group are low. In Brazil, the vaccine towards Covid-19 is issued solely to kids aged 6 months to 2 years and to kids over 3 years of age (no matter well being elements).
Only, from the start of the yr to November, greater than 477 deaths from extreme acute respiratory syndrome (SRAG) related to Covid had been confirmed in Brazil in infants and youngsters as much as 5 years of age. In the identical interval, there have been solely 32 deaths from influenza (flu).
Myth 4: Using hand sanitizer is sufficient to stop Covid-19
At the start of the epidemic, gel alcohol and hand hygiene had been thought of the 2 principal protecting measures towards Covid-19. Although they’re nonetheless vital, science has discovered that the primary type of virus transmission is just not by contact with contaminated surfaces.
According to the pair of scientists, “SARS-CoV-2 is unfold by tiny particles of moisture suspended within the air, known as aerosols”. Thus, sufficient air flow of areas – equivalent to conserving home windows open – and masks are important to cut back transmission.

Myth 6: Vaccines are now not efficient
At the second, first-generation vaccines – constructed from the unique pressure of the coronavirus – are nonetheless efficient in stopping extreme varieties and loss of life. Additionally, they shield towards covid for a very long time. However, as really useful by well being consultants, they must be up to date every now and then by booster doses. Today, for instance, a fifth dose of the vaccine is already out there to some individuals in Brazil.
Pharmaceuticals Moderna and Pfizer additionally developed the primary bivalent formulations to enhance the immune response towards Omicron and its progenitors, equivalent to BA.4 and BA.5. This means they shield towards two strains of the virus in the identical scheme because the flu vaccine. Soon, these doses ought to attain Brazilians and with it, they’ll improve the protection towards the virus.
